We have seen problems with XP PC's when the built-in Firewall is  
enabled.  If you have this please try disabling the Firewall to see if  
the Line State works.

> OK. i've found a solution , JTAPI password was bad, but when I'm logged
> in I can not retrieve call state in directory window . I read that it
> was a problem in ccm 3.1 and lower but it was resolved in upper
> versions. We are using ccm 4.0(1) and initial line state show Unknown
> status for all directory numbers.
